One Poster map: tower on one side, ruins in a desert(?) on the other.
Adventure Book One: 32 pages. Good paperstock.
First few pages discuss how to get the PCs into the adventure, including about 10 rumours and lots and lots of suggestions. Map of Spellguard - several locations to explore. An adventure log for players.
Ooh... Rival adventurers!
Bunches and bunches of wandering monsters, split into Hostile Encounters and Social Encounters. That's a very, very cool idea.
Two "delve" format outdoor encounters that can be used as "set piece" encounters as the party is travelling around Spellgard.
Seven pages of pictures, quite good artwork I feel.
Adventure Book Two has 31 encounters in the three major locations of Spellgard: the Ramparts on the perimeter of the ruins, the Catacombs that lie beneath the Tower, and the Tower itself.
